HUMBLE GENIUS

-

Thanks for the excellent tribute to Peter Green who sadly died on my birthday, which really put a damper on the day, especially as it was only a couple of years after Danny Kirwan’s passing.

Apart from both being exceptiona­l guitarists and their stars coming into alignment all too briefly in Fleetwood Mac, they both seemed to find it hard to accept the talent they had. I saw Peter in a restaurant in Brighton with family a few years ago, our paths crossed literally on our way to the gents. I couldn’t pass up the opportunit­y to tell him how much his music meant to me and that Love That Burns, with his guitar and vocals and that haunting sax and piano fade-out, would be my choice if l was only allowed one piece of music on this planet. He muttered a thanks but that was about it.

When he and his party left they walked past our table but he stared straight ahead. It didn’t bother me, after all l’d read enough about how introspect­ive he’d become, but as they got to the door he stopped, turned round gave me a thumbs up and a huge smile. Did he ever realise just how good he was or what an inspiratio­n he had been? I just hope so, certainly Joe Bonamassa is right when he says the trinity of British guitar royalty in Beck, Page and Clapton really should be a quartet.

Terry Holmes, via email

Many thanks for sharing that charming memory of Peter, Terry – it chimes with what so many others have said about him: a man of huge talent who was ill at ease with receiving adulation for what came naturally. We think Bonamassa is right in that assessment, too. It’s impossible to say whether he would have gained the same recognitio­n as Clapton et al had he not lost years to the well-documented mental turmoil he experience­d after using psychedeli­cs. However, we suspect that he was just one of those modest yet spirituall­y alive artists who feel their music comes from a source larger than themselves. Not every genius has an ego the size of a planet, and fame, in and of itself, isn’t what true artists are focused on.
